Responsibilities

  • Perform major bodywork to bring vehicle back to factory standards.
  • Light welding (Stinger gun stud welding)
  • Glass repairs (RR and RI)
  • Metal prep/work/ treatment (epoxy/primer/surfacers)
  • Using all body refinish surfacers
  • Repair and refinish vehicle
  • Shrinking/sculpture metal panels
  • Blocking, wet sanding, hammering, dolling procedures
  • Adjusting doors, panels and hoods
  • Hazmat training
  • Safety knowledge of chemicals and equipment practices
  • Mechanic safety knowledge such as how to disconnect vehicles properly prior to performing bodywork
  • Raw plastic prepping
  • E-Coat prep
  • Resurface and refinish all (RR/ RI) of all vehicle panels and interiors and color matching for door jambs
  • Mixing bench, (how to weigh and use formulas)
  • Body Work- Panels, Glass, Jambs
  • Inspect and notate vehicle damage
  • Apply mask tape over vehicle parts/windows
  • Buff, Color Sand, Primer, Body filling, Spray inner jambs, Sealers and seam sealer for new parts
  • Remove/Install windshields
  • Undercoating and applying rock guard protector
